
Corporate issues involving fraudulent accounting, malfeasance and data quality issues frequently dominate news headlines; CEOs and Boards of Directors (BoD) are under public scrutiny and, as a result, regulatory requirements have emerged to address these issues using commonly accepted principals of corporate governance. Enterprise Content Management (ECM) frameworks play a key role in allowing organizations to provide compliance and corporate governance in a cost effective and efficient manner to achieve the following business goals:
- Have a reliable means to store and retrieve business-critical and sensitive information .
- Have the means to track regulatory deliverables and certifications.
- Ensure your disclosure and reporting processes are efficient and within budget.
- Have an integrated means of managing business records -- from creation to maintenance to eventual destruction.
- Have employees effectively communicate and fulfil task requirements.
- Have an established training certification program.
